Bug Description

Binary package hint: empathy

Whenever I launch Empathy and it attempts to connect I get a dialog which states the certificate is invalid and asking me to confirm or cancel (see srceenshot). Then I check the box "remember my decision" and click on continue. The next time I launch Empathy the same message will be shown again. Ticking the checkbox didn't have any result.
